Normal appendicography

Coloured normal appendicography. Appendicography is a contrast diagnostic procedure that may be performed in suspected cases of appendicitis. The patient drinks a barium sulphate meal and then undergoes an abdominal X-ray 8 hours later. Here the barium contrast material (dark green) is filling the caecum, ascending colon and appendix., by RAJAAISYA/SCIENCE PHOTO LIBRARY
